Job description

As a Quality Technician, you’ll play a pivotal role in ensuring product excellence. This is a high-impact, independent position where your technical expertise and decision-making drive real results. You’ll navigate digital systems, manage critical product dispositions, and collaborate across teams to resolve challenges in real-time. If you’re looking for a role that values your initiative, supports your professional growth, and makes a tangible impact on our operations, we invite you to join our team. The role is from 7am-3pm, M-F.

Core Responsibilities
  • Quality Lab Operations: Support daily lab functions, manage lab inventory, and facilitate equipment maintenance and calibration.

  • Product Testing & Analysis: Perform testing and inspections across production stages (including product age and retesting) in compliance with ISO 9001 standards.

  • Floor Support: Provide guidance to manufacturing teams, troubleshoot quality issues, and assist in root-cause problem solving.

  • Data & Documentation: Maintain accurate records, manage retained samples, and enter data into our core systems (QIS, MFGPro, Google Sheets, AODocs, and MARS).

  • Process Improvement: Participate in continuous improvement initiatives (e.g., ELS events) and support quality-related training for manufacturing personnel.

  • Operational Excellence: Ensure adherence to safety protocols and operating standards to minimize downtime and scrap.

Site & Division-Specific Tasks

Depending on site location and workflow, you may also be assigned the following responsibilities:

  • Supplier Documentation: Manage incoming and outgoing Certificates of Analysis (CoAs) and resolve documentation gaps with suppliers and internal testing.

  • Customer Support: Prepare and distribute test reports, respond to customer inquiries, and act as a key QA contact during audits.

  • Risk Coordination: Attend tier meetings to communicate testing status and shipment risks.

Safety Standards
  • Consistently practice all health and safety policies.

  • Maintain a clean, organized work environment.

  • Participate in required safety training and lead lab-specific safety initiatives.

Avery Dennison Corporation (NYSE: AVY) is a global materials science and digital identification solutions company. We are Making Possible products and solutions that help advance the industries we serve, providing branding and information solutions that optimize labor and supply chain efficiency, reduce waste and mitigate loss, advance sustainability, circularity and transparency and better connect brands and consumers. We design and develop labeling and functional materials, radio-frequency identification (RFID) inlays and tags, software applications that connect the physical and digital and offerings that enhance branded packaging and carry or display information that improves the customer experience. Serving industries worldwide — including home and personal care, apparel, general retail, e-commerce, logistics, food and grocery, pharmaceuticals and automotive — we employ approximately 35,000 employees in more than 50 countries. Our reported sales in 2025 were $8.9 billion. Learn more at www.averydennison.com.
